Abstract
Experiments were performed in anesthetized dogs to study some effects of propranolol, dextro-propranolol and ICI50,172 on digitalis-induced arrhythmias and digitalis-induced sensitization to electrical shock. When given in beta-blocking doses, propranolol did not abbreviate ouabain-induced ventricular tachycardia (VT) or decrease ouabain-induced sensitization to electrical shock. In larger doses, propranolol first controlled the arrhythmia without affecting shock sensitivity and then abolished both arrhythmia and shock sensitivity. Dextro-propranolol, a compound with nonspecific antiarrhythmic action equal to that of propranolol but with virtually no beta-blocking effect, abolished shock sensitivity, whereas ICI50,172, a pure beta-blocking agent, did not. Beta-blocking doses of propranolol given to dogs bordering on digitalis toxicity but in normal sinus rhythm caused recurrence of sustained ventricular tachycardia. Reappearance of toxicity appeared to be related to a propranolol-induced decrease in heart rate, since it was averted during continuous electrical pacing of the atrium and reversed by isoproterenol administration.

Abstract
The effects of intravenous and oral administration of propranolol, an adrenergic beta-receptor blocking agent, have been studied in 29 patients with various cardiac arrhythmias. The ventricular responses in chronic or paroxysmal ectopic supraventricular arrhythmias were decreased at rest or during exercise. Sinus tachycardias were regularly slowed. Two supraventricular tachycardias and one ventricular tachycardia, all consistently precipitated by exogenous stimuli, were prevented. Six instances of digitalis-induced arrhythmias were responsive to treatment.
Propranolol, especially when given orally, is of definite value in selected disturbances of cardiac rhythm. Reasonable caution should be exercised, however, because of the risk of precipitation of congestive heart failure or hypotension in patients with limited cardiac reserves.
